Q(–1, a) is 4 √5 units away from P(3, –2). Find all possible values of a.

Respuesta :

surjithayer10 surjithayer10
  • 02-11-2020

Answer:

a=6,-10

Step-by-step explanation:

[tex]4\sqrt{5}=\sqrt{(3+1)^2+(-2-a)^2} \\squaring\\80=16+(2+a)^2\\80-16=(2+a)^2\\(a+2)^2=64\\taking~square ~root\\\\a+2=\pm 8\\either \\a+2=8,\\a=8-2=6\\or\\a+2=-8\\a=-8-2=-10[/tex]
